Output 569623a40e30de3369cd582473420429caa2104f82102f11bea89074a2e7002c:71

value
237625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a38b4b6451209c53a3348e16d8091d92e5193e OP_EQUAL
address
37wwnqFu1U5jJWeoWDkCETE5pgUFBjHzvc
transaction
569623a40e30de3369cd582473420429caa2104f82102f11bea89074a2e7002c
confirmations
282655
spent
true